My Buying Guides on Realistic Artificial Fish That Swim

When I first looked into getting realistic artificial fish that swim, I realized there’s more to consider than just picking the coolest-looking fish. Here’s what I learned through my experience and what helped me make the best choice.

1. Understanding What Makes Them Realistic

For me, realism comes down to movement and appearance. The best artificial fish mimic the natural swimming patterns and have detailed colors and textures that look just like real fish. I always check videos or customer reviews to see how lifelike the swimming action is before buying.

2. Types of Swimming Mechanisms

There are generally two types I found: battery-operated fish with small motors and remote-controlled fish. Battery-operated ones tend to swim in simple, repetitive patterns, which is fine for a calming effect. Remote-controlled fish give you more control over where and how they swim, but they can be pricier and require more maintenance.

3. Size and Aquarium Compatibility

I had to think about the size of my tank and how many artificial fish I wanted. Some fish are small and perfect for nano tanks, while others need a bigger space to swim freely. I also made sure the material wouldn’t harm the water quality or my real plants and decorations.

4. Battery Life and Maintenance**

Battery life varies a lot. I prefer fish that can run for at least a couple of hours on one charge or set of batteries. Also, consider how easy it is to replace batteries or recharge them. Cleaning is another factor since algae or water deposits can affect their performance.

5. Safety and Material Quality

Since these fish live in water, I pay close attention to the materials used. Non-toxic, waterproof, and durable materials are a must. I avoid anything that looks cheap or might break down easily, as that could pollute the tank or harm real fish.

6. Price vs. Value

I found prices range widely, from budget-friendly options to high-end models with advanced features. I balance cost with the features I want—realistic movement, durability, and battery life. Sometimes spending a bit more upfront saves me frustration down the line.

7. Additional Features to Look For

Some artificial fish come with cool extras like LED lights, customizable swimming patterns, or the ability to sync multiple fish together. I personally enjoy these features, but they depend on your preferences and budget.

8. Where to Buy

I found the best deals and variety online, especially on platforms that specialize in aquarium supplies. Reading user reviews and watching demonstration videos helped me avoid low-quality products.
